Get Money Quotes -Financial Advice Quotes
1. “The stock market is filled with individuals who know the price of everything, but the value of nothing.” – Phillip Fisher
2. “Wealth is not his that has it, but his that enjoys it.” – Benjamin Franklin
3. “It’s not how much money you make, but how much money you keep, how hard it works for you, and how many generations you keep it for.” – Robert Kiyosaki
4. “The habit of saving is itself an education; it fosters every virtue, teaches self-denial, cultivates the sense of order, trains to forethought, and so broadens the mind.” – T.T. Munger
5. “Don’t tell me what you value, show me your budget, and I’ll tell you what you value.” – Joe Biden
6. “Wealth, after all, is a relative thing since he that has little and wants less is richer than he that has much and wants more.” – Charles Caleb Colton
7. “When buying shares, ask yourself, would you buy the whole company?” – Rene Rivkin
8. “If you have trouble imagining a 20% loss in the stock market, you shouldn’t be in stocks.” – John Bogle
9. “My old father used to have a saying: If you make a bad bargain, hug it all the tighter.” – Abraham Lincoln
10. “It takes as much energy to wish as it does to plan.” – Eleanor Roosevelt
11. “The four most expensive words in the English language are, ‘This time it’s different.’” – Sir John Templeton
12. “I’d like to live as a poor man with lots of money.” – Pablo Picasso
13. “Fortune sides with him who dares.” – Virgil
14. “Wealth is like sea-water; the more we drink, the thirstier we become; and the same is true of fame.” – Arthur Schopenhauer
15. “If we command our wealth, we shall be rich and free. If our wealth commands us, we are poor indeed.” – Edmund Burke
16. “No wealth can ever make a bad man at peace with himself.” – Plato
17. “My formula for success is rise early, work late and strike oil.” – JP Getty
18. “There is a gigantic difference between earning a great deal of money and being rich.” – Marlene Dietrich
19. “Money is usually attracted, not pursued.” – Jim Rohn
20. “A simple fact that is hard to learn is that the time to save money is when you have some.” – Joe Moore
21. “Don’t tell me where your priorities are. Show me where you spend your money and I’ll tell you what they are.” – James W. Frick
22. “If you would be wealthy, think of saving as well as getting.” – Benjamin Franklin
23. “Many folks think they aren’t good at earning money, when what they don’t know is how to use it.” – Frank A. Clark
24. “Money is not the most important thing in the world. Love is. Fortunately, I love money.” – Jackie Mason
25. “While money doesn’t buy love, it puts you in a great bargaining position.” – Christopher Marlowe
